国产精品久久久aaaa,日日干夜夜操天天插,亚洲乱熟女香蕉一区二区三区少妇,99精品国产高清一区二区三区,国产成人精品一区二区色戒,久久久国产精品成人免费,亚洲精品毛片久久久久,99久久婷婷国产综合精品电影,国产一区二区三区任你鲁

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

如何時候不然低速、全速和高速USB及工作原理

RTThread物聯網操作系統 ? 來源:strongerHuang ? 作者:strongerHuang ? 2021-09-07 15:17 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

USB應用的比較廣泛,從 USB 0.1版本到現在的 UBS 4,經歷了各項技術的升級。

1寫在前面

USB:Universal Serial Bus,通用串行總線。

USB最初由英特爾與微軟倡導發起,最大的特點是盡可能的實現熱插拔和即插即用。

USB總線是差分信號嗎?什么是USB 2.0、USB 3.0?什么是低速、全速、高速?什么是Type-A、Type-B、Type-C

針對這些疑問,本文講述USB相關的一些基礎知識。

2USB發展歷程

較早版本

USB 0.7:1994年11月發布。

USB 0.8:1994年12月發布。

USB 0.9:1995年4月發布。

USB 0.99:1995年8月發布。

USB 1.0 RC:1995年11月發布。

USB 1.0:1996年1月發布

數據傳輸速率為1.5Mbit/s(Low-Speed)。無預測及通過檢測功能。僅極少數出現在市場上。

USB 1.1:1998年9月發布

修正1.0版已發現的問題,大部分是關于USB Hubs。最早被采用的修訂版。數據傳輸速率為12Mbit/s(Full-Speed)。

USB 2.0:2000年4月發布

增加更高的數據傳輸速率480Mbit/s(現在稱作Hi-Speed),但受限于BOT傳輸協議和NRZI編碼方式,實際最高傳輸速度只有35MByte/s左右。

USB OTG(On-The-Go)是USB2.0規格的補充標準。

USB 3.0:2008年11月發布

速度由480Mbps大幅提升到5Gbps,USB 3.0插座通常是藍色的,并向下兼容USB 2.0。

USB 3.1:2013年7月31日發布

傳輸速度提升為10Gb/s,比USB3.0的5Gb/s快上一倍,并向下兼容USB 2.0/1.0,電力供應可高達100W。

USB 3.2

在現有的USB Type-C數據在線實現雙通道,使用USB 3.2主機連接USB 3.2存儲設備,可以實現兩條通道10Gb/s的傳輸速度,理論上也就是相當接近于20Gb/s。

USB 4:2019年9月3日發布

采用Thunderbolt 3協議規格,使Thunderbolt 3設備將能兼容于USB 4,現有3.2及2.0也向下兼容。速度方面加倍來到兩條通道總共40Gb/s的傳輸速度。

3USB版本

USB-IF當前正式的主版本號只有USB 2.0和USB 3.2兩個。

(USB-IF:USB Implementers Forum,USB標準化組織)

USB標準化組織主版本只有兩個,但現在USB標準中,按照速度等級和連接方式分為以下幾種版本:USB 1.0、 1.1、 2.0、 3.0、 3.1、 3.2。

之前寫過一篇文章:USB4規范正式公布,傳輸帶寬高達40Gbps。

準確的說,主版本號除了USB 2.0和USB 3.2,還應該有一個USB4。

上面那張圖信息量有點大,你會發現我們學習、開發板上使用的基本都是USB 2.0版本(低速、全速、高速),也是眾多嵌入式產品中常用的一種。

4USB接口

現在流行于手機中的一種接口【Type-C】,相信絕大部分人都知道。

Type-C屬于USB中一種較新的接口,在這之前其實還有Type-A和Type-B(可能很多人不知道)。

下面給一張圖:

c87b90c0-0f8b-11ec-8fb8-12bb97331649.jpg

你會發現接口的觸點有4個的,也有5個的。其中多的那個引腳為USB_ID,主要用于OTG(On-The-Go)主設備和從設備。

OTG設備使用插頭中的ID引腳來區分A/B Device,ID接地被稱作為A-Device,充當USB Host,A-Device始終為總線并提供電力。

ID懸空被稱作為B-Device,充當USB Device。設備的USB Host/USB Device角色可以通過HNP(主機交換協議)切換。

5USB設備識別

USB信號使用分別標記為D+和D- 的雙絞線傳輸,它們各自使用半雙工的差分信號并協同工作,以抵消長導線的電磁干擾。

因為USB設備類型有很多,同時又做了兼容,因此就需要對不同設備進行識別。

這里講述一下低速、全速和高速設備的識別原理(官方有手冊)。

5.1 低速和全速設備識別

低速(Low Speed)和全速(Full Speed)設備區分方法比較簡單:在設備端有一個1.5k的上拉電阻,當設備插入hub或上電(固定線纜的USB設備)時,有上拉電阻的那根數據線就會被拉高,hub根據D+/D-上的電平判斷所掛載的是全速設備還是低速設備。

低速設備1.5K上拉電阻位于D-

全速設備1.5K上拉電阻位于D+

如下圖:

c896c1ec-0f8b-11ec-8fb8-12bb97331649.jpg

5.2 高速設備識別

(上面)USB低速和全速的識別比較簡單,但只有一對D+和D-數據線,高速設備就不能再像上面那樣僅依靠數據線上拉電阻來識別。

高速設備初始是以一個全速設備的身份出現,和全速設備一樣,D+線上有一個1.5k的上拉電阻。USB2.0的hub把它當作一個全速設備,之后,hub和設備通過一系列握手信號確認雙方的身份。

c8a7332e-0f8b-11ec-8fb8-12bb97331649.png

如上圖,hub檢測到有設備插入/上電時,向主機通報,主機發送Set_Port_Feature請求讓hub復位新插入的設備。設備復位操作是hub通過驅動數據線到復位狀態SE0(Single-ended 0,即D+和D-全為低電平),并持續至少10ms。

具體識別過程相對復雜,具體可見下面描述:

c8b17c62-0f8b-11ec-8fb8-12bb97331649.jpg

編輯:jq

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• usb
    usb
    +關注

    關注

    60

    文章

    8440

    瀏覽量

    284498
  • 差分信號
    +關注

    關注

    4

    文章

    408

    瀏覽量

    29010
  • 通用串行總線

    關注

    0

    文章

    37

    瀏覽量

    16991

原文標題:USB低速、全速和高速如何識別,及工作原理

文章出處:【微信號:RTThread,微信公眾號:RTThread物聯網操作系統】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    探秘TUSB212:USB 2.0高速信號調節器的卓越性能與應用

    通道中ISI(碼間干擾)信號損失而設計的USB高速(HS)信號調節器。它具有專利設計,對USB低速(LS)和全速(FS)信號無影響,僅對
    的頭像 發表于 02-28 16:50 ?494次閱讀

    ISOUSB111DWR 支持低速全速的低發射隔離式 USB 中繼器

    ISOUSB111DWR支持低速全速的低發射隔離式USB中繼器產品型號:ISOUSB111DWR產品品牌:TI/德州儀器產品封裝:SOIC16產品功能:隔離式USB中繼器芯片
    的頭像 發表于 02-03 11:32 ?313次閱讀
    ISOUSB111DWR  支持<b class='flag-5'>低速</b>和<b class='flag-5'>全速</b>的低發射隔離式 <b class='flag-5'>USB</b> 中繼器

    TUSB8041:四端口 USB 3.0 集線器的卓越之選

    upstream 端口同時提供 SuperSpeed USB高速/全速連接,而在 downstream 端口則可提供 SuperSpeed USB
    的頭像 發表于 12-22 18:10 ?1180次閱讀

    ?Microchip EVB-USB5926評估板技術解析與應用指南

    。EVB-USB5926符合USB 3.2(Gen1)規范,支持超高速(SS)、高速(HS)、全速(FS)和
    的頭像 發表于 10-09 10:29 ?823次閱讀
    ?Microchip EVB-<b class='flag-5'>USB</b>5926評估板技術解析與應用指南

    Microchip EVB-USB580x評估板技術解析與應用指南

    和接口選項的演示和評估平臺。EVB-USB5807和EVB-USB5806板符合USB 3.1(Gen1)規范, 支持超高速(SS)、高速
    的頭像 發表于 10-09 10:24 ?792次閱讀
    Microchip EVB-<b class='flag-5'>USB</b>580x評估板技術解析與應用指南

    USB2534D USB 2.0高速4端口集線器控制器技術解析

    應用的高級特性。USB2534D完全符合USB 2.0規范和USB 2.0鏈路電源管理附錄,將作為全速集線器或全速/
    的頭像 發表于 09-29 10:54 ?788次閱讀
    <b class='flag-5'>USB</b>2534D <b class='flag-5'>USB</b> 2.0<b class='flag-5'>高速</b>4端口集線器控制器技術解析

    TUSB2E11 USB 2.0/eUSB2中繼器技術解析與應用指南

    Texas Instruments TUSB2E11 USB 2.0 eUSB2中繼器設計用于支持器件和主機模式。TUSB2E11支持USB低速 (LS)、全速 (FS) 和
    的頭像 發表于 09-12 11:36 ?1014次閱讀
    TUSB2E11 <b class='flag-5'>USB</b> 2.0/eUSB2中繼器技術解析與應用指南

    請問如何將USB設備設置為全速設備或高速設備?

    如何將USB設備設置為全速設備或高速設備?
    發表于 08-28 06:27

    GL850G(創惟) USB2.0HUB國產替代方案-GM8220(振芯) P2P

    完整的掃描鏈,內建自測試模式,可工作高速全速、低速三種模式。芯片可 支持充電,可為便攜式設備提供充電。 主要應用于獨立的 USB hub
    發表于 06-09 15:00

    ADUM4160全速/低速USB數字隔離器技術手冊

    ADuM4160是一款基于ADI公司*i*Coupler?技術的USB端口隔離器。它將高速CMOS工藝與單片空芯變壓器技術相結合,可提供優異的工作性能,并且很容易與低速
    的頭像 發表于 06-05 14:45 ?1341次閱讀
    ADUM4160<b class='flag-5'>全速</b>/<b class='flag-5'>低速</b><b class='flag-5'>USB</b>數字隔離器技術手冊

    ADUM3160全速/低速USB數字隔離器技術手冊

    ADuM3160是一款采用ADI公司**i**Coupler^?^ 技術的[USB]端口隔離器,它將高速CMOS工藝與單片空芯變壓器技術相結合,可提供優異的工作性能,并且很容易與低速
    的頭像 發表于 06-05 11:37 ?1679次閱讀
    ADUM3160<b class='flag-5'>全速</b>/<b class='flag-5'>低速</b><b class='flag-5'>USB</b>數字隔離器技術手冊

    ADuM4165/ADuM4166用于隔離式 USB 2.0 高速(上游時鐘輸入)的5.7kV rms 數字隔離器技術手冊

    ADuM4165/ADuM4166^1^ 是 USB 2.0 端口隔離器,利用 ADI 公司的 *i*Couple^? ^技術,可根據需要,來動態支持所有 USB 2.0 數據速率,包括低速
    的頭像 發表于 05-29 15:46 ?1474次閱讀
    ADuM4165/ADuM4166用于隔離式 <b class='flag-5'>USB</b> 2.0 <b class='flag-5'>高速</b>(上游時鐘輸入)的5.7kV rms 數字隔離器技術手冊

    第二十二章 USB 全速設備接口(USB)

    本文介紹了W55MH32的USB全速設備接口,其符合USB2.0規范,可配1-8個端點,支持同步傳輸、雙緩沖機制及掛起/恢復。含SIE等模塊,數據傳輸基于令牌分組,涉及端點初始化、控制傳輸等內容,與CAN共享512字節SRAM。
    的頭像 發表于 05-29 15:07 ?1412次閱讀
    第二十二章 <b class='flag-5'>USB</b> <b class='flag-5'>全速</b>設備接口(<b class='flag-5'>USB</b>)

    MAX4906EF高速/全速USB 2.0開關,提供高ESD保護技術手冊

    ESD條件下提供保護而無閂鎖或者損壞。適合在480Mbps高速USB 2.0應用中用作高性能開關。這些開關還可處理低速全速USB信號。
    的頭像 發表于 05-26 15:49 ?1953次閱讀
    MAX4906EF<b class='flag-5'>高速</b>/<b class='flag-5'>全速</b><b class='flag-5'>USB</b> 2.0開關,提供高ESD保護技術手冊

    MAX4983E/MAX4984E高速USB 2.0開關,具有±15kV ESD保護技術手冊

    閉鎖或者損壞。這兩款器件非常適合在480Mbps高速USB 2.0中應用。這些開關還可處理低速全速USB信號。
    的頭像 發表于 05-26 15:28 ?1118次閱讀
    MAX4983E/MAX4984E<b class='flag-5'>高速</b><b class='flag-5'>USB</b> 2.0開關,具有±15kV ESD保護技術手冊